The $p^n$ theorem for semisimple Hopf algebras

Author(s): Akira Masuoka
Journal: Proc. Amer. Math. Soc. 124 (1996), 735-737.

Abstract: We give an algebraic version of a result of G. I. Kac, showing that a semisimple Hopf algebra $A$ of dimension $p^n$, where $p$ is a prime and $n>0$, over an algebraically closed field of characteristic 0 contains a non-trivial central group-like. As an application we prove that, if $n=2$, $A$ is isomorphic to a group algebra.
